vmem.library/--background---                     vmem.library/--background---


                       THE ** VIRTUAL MEMORY ** LIBRARY

                               ( VERSION 1 )

                       COPYRIGHT (c) 1994 BY LEE BRAIDEN


       These are the autodocs for programming vmem.library. VMem is a very
   simple set of six (6) functions, and four (4) macros. All you need to do
   to use VMem is :

       * Call vmAllocBlock (or use the macro vmAllocData) to get a control
         handle. (This is used by VMem to keep track of what's happening
         to your data).

       * Call vmLock (or use the macro vmLockData) to get a lock on the
         data you wanna use at that time.

       * Access your data.

       * Call vmUnLock (or use the macro vmUnLockData) to unlock the data
         again.

       * Call vmFreeBlock (or use the macro vmFreeData) to free the control
         handle you got by calling vmAllocBlock (or using vmAllocData)


       The macro versions of the four functions just a simple way to alloc
   one element of data without the extra args required by the functions.
   (The functions have extra options to cope with array use.


       The other two (2) functions are replacements for exec.library's
   AllocMem() and FreeMem() functions. They provide a few more functions
   than exec's versions, including flushing Virtual Memory if exec's
   AllocMem would normally fail.

       See the individual autodocs below for a more detailed explanation.

vmem.library/vmAllocBlock                           vmem.library/vmAllocBlock

   NAME   
           vmAllocBlock

   SYNOPSIS
           vmBlock *vmb = vmAllocBlock(ULONG size,ULONG nels,ULONG memflags)
                     d0                  d0          d1          d2

   FUNCTION
           Allocates a vmBlock for control of data which will use virtual
       memory.

   INPUTS

       size:
       -   size of each element in array
       nels:
       -   number of elements in array
       memflags:
       -   standard exec.library/AllocMem() memory attribute flags

   RESULT

       vmb:
       -   Virtual memory control handle (vmBlock).This block stores
           information about your data,and is passed to the other
           virtual memory functions to let them know what state your
           data is in.

   EXAMPLE

       vmBlock *vmb;
       struct Preferences *prefs_ptr;/*largest structure I could think of*/
       ULONG i;
       ...

       if(!(vmb = vmAllocBlock(sizeof(struct Preferences),10,MEMF_PUBLIC)))
       {
           /*  vmAllocBlock failed - you're either *VERY* low on memory,
               or the the path that vmem.library is using is full */

           ...

       }else
       {
           for(i=0;i<NUM_ELS;i++)
           {
               if(!(prefs_ptr = vmLock(vmb,i)))
               {
                   /* data lock failed - disk error , or VERY low on mem */
                   ....

               }else
               {
                   /* you've got your data,do whatever you want with it */

                   ....

                   /*  unlock the data when you've finished with it,so vmem
                       will know when it's not in use */ 

                   vmUnLock(vmb,i);

               };
           };

           /*  when you've finished with all the data, free the control
               block */
                
          vmFreeBlock(vmb);
       };




   NOTES

   BUGS

       Doesn't handle saving across multiple disks/devices yet.

vmem.library/vmFlush                                     vmem.library/vmFlush

   NAME   
           vmFlush

   SYNOPSIS
           ULONG memflushed = vmFlush(ULONG memneeded,ULONG memflags);
                   d0                      d0              d1

   FUNCTION
           Flushes required amount unused virtual memory from the system.

   INPUTS
           memneeded:
           -   Amount of *ADDITIONAL* free memory you need in bytes.
           memflags:
           -   Type of memory to flush (standard exec.library/AllocMem
               memory attributes)

   RESULT
           memflushed:
           -   Amount of memory you got (in bytes).

   EXAMPLE

   NOTES
           memflushed is the memory that was freed into the free memory
       list by this function - by the time it returns,another program
       might have pulled it from under you, so check results of vmAllocMem
       even if this function tells you there's enough mem.

vmem.library/vmUnLock                                   vmem.library/vmUnLock

   NAME   
           vmUnLock

   SYNOPSIS
           void vmUnLock(vmBlock *b,ULONG el)
                               a0          d0

   FUNCTION
           Unlocks a virtual memory data element which was locked by
       vmLock().

   INPUTS
       b:
       -   pointer to the virtual memory control block for the data.
       el:
       -   The number of the element to unlock.

   RESULT
           Unlocks the data.When data has no more locks on it,
       and real memory gets low,the data will be saved to a vmem file,
       and the real memory is freed.

   EXAMPLE

       See vmAllocBlock()'s example, above.

   NOTES
           Note that this function takes the NUMBER of the element you
       wish to unlock,and not a pointer to the data as you might expect.
